Static emotional flags create brittle, repetitive NPC interactions that break immersion and scale poorly. A custom automation workflow continuously updates an NPC's emotional state based on player dialogue sentiment, environmental events, and relationship history. This living model, powered by a real-time sentiment classifier and a state machine, becomes the primary input for a low-latency dialogue generator. The result is NPCs that remember slights, celebrate with the player, and react organically to world events, transforming player interaction from a scripted tree into a dynamic conversation system that drives engagement and reduces manual scripting for vast open worlds.




